RESEARCH INSTITUTE OF THE MUHC
The Research Institute of the McGill University Health Centre (RI-MUHC) is a world-renowned biomedical and hospital research centre.

Located in Montreal, Quebec, the Institute is the research arm of the McGill University Health Centre (MUHC) affiliated with the Faculty of Medicine at McGill University.

The RI-MUHC is supported in part by the Fonds de recherche du Québec - Santé (FRQS).

Position summary

We seek a highly motivated, organized and meticulous individual with great attention to detail for a full-time position, to support the research activities of the Histopathology Platform and actively participate in its scientific development.

General Duties

  • Execute routine histology procedures including tissue processing and embedding,
  • Perform routine sectioning using microtome or cryostat (including frozen unfixed tissues),
  • Carry out H&E and special staining,
  • Prepare solutions in accordance to standard operating procedures,
  • Clean and maintain instruments as well as all work areas in excellent condition,
  • Dispose of hazardous chemical waste per regulatory guidelines,
  • Document and maintain record of quality controlrelated information,
  • Maintain inventory of supplies and coordinate equipment maintenance,
  • Prepare and set up material and equipment, perform a variety of assays, analyses and tests,
  • Assist Platform users in the development of methodological tools for their individual projects,
  • Respond promptly to queries and requests for information,
  • Troubleshoot, correct and adapt published methodologies
  • Conduct other related tasks as assigned by the Platform Manager.
